Defensive slides
Builds the lateral quickness and stance for on-ball defence.
What it works
Glute med, Quads
How to do it
- 1In a low, wide defensive stance, slide laterally by pushing off the trailing foot without ever crossing your feet, staying square to an imaginary attacker.
- 2It builds the lateral quickness and stance endurance for on-ball defence.
- 3Stay low the whole time — standing up between slides is the most common fault.
Cues that matter
- ›Low, wide stance
- ›Push don't cross the feet
- ›Stay square to your man
